Understanding the Enemy: Bed Bugs
Bed bugs are small, flat insects that feed on human blood. They can be found in homes, hotels, and other places where people sleep. These pests are notorious for causing discomfort and disrupting sleep patterns. To effectively eliminate them, it's crucial to understand their behavior and habitats.
Identifying Bed Bugs
Bed bugs are about the size of an apple seed, with a reddish-brown color. They have six legs and a flat, oval-shaped body. After feeding, they turn a deeper shade of red due to the blood they've consumed. Look for these pests in cracks and crevices around beds, furniture, and walls.

Preparing for Treatment
Before using any bed bug spray, it's essential to prepare your home for treatment. Here are some steps to follow:
Wash and Dry Bedding
Wash all bedding, including sheets, blankets, and comforters, in hot water and dry them on high heat. This will help kill any bed bugs or eggs that may be hiding in your bedding.
Vacuum Thoroughly
Use a vacuum cleaner with a hose attachment to thoroughly vacuum all surfaces, paying special attention to cracks and crevices around beds, furniture, and walls. Dispose of the vacuum bag or empty the canister after each use to prevent bed bugs from escaping.
Remove Clutter
Bed bugs often hide in cluttered areas, so remove any unnecessary items from your bedroom. This will make it easier to identify and treat infested areas.
Applying the Spray
Once you've prepared your home for treatment, it's time to apply the bed bug spray. Follow these steps:
Read the Instructions
Before applying the spray, read the instructions on the label carefully. Make sure you understand how to use the product safely and effectively.
Spray All Surfaces
Apply the spray to all surfaces where bed bugs may be hiding, including mattresses, box springs, headboards, and walls. Be sure to spray into cracks and crevices, as well as along baseboards and behind wallpaper.
Allow the Spray to Dry
After applying the spray, allow it to dry completely before replacing any bedding or furniture. This will help ensure that the insecticide works effectively.
Follow-Up Treatment
After the initial treatment, it's crucial to follow up with additional treatments to ensure that all bed bugs have been eliminated. Repeat the treatment process every 7-10 days until no more bed bugs are visible.
Prevention is Key
To prevent future infestations, take the following steps:
Inspect Second-Hand Items
Before bringing any second-hand items into your home, inspect them thoroughly for signs of bed bugs.
Use Bed Bug-Proof Mattress Covers
Use mattress covers that are designed to prevent bed bugs from entering or escaping. These covers can be found at most home goods stores.
Regularly Check for Bed Bugs
Regularly check your home for signs of bed bugs, such as small, red or brown spots on sheets or walls, or live bugs in cracks and crevices.
